Retrouvaille is a three-phase program for marriages that helps couples face their marriage challenges in a productive and healthy way. It begins with the online weekend program, followed by online post weekend follow up sessions, and ongoing monthly marriage support offered online, as well.
Phase 1: The Retrouvaille Weekend Experience
Retrouvaille begins with a weekend experience in which couples are helped to re-establish communication and to gain new insights into themselves as individuals and as a couple. This part of the program is presented by three couples and a clergy member. The presenting team has experienced disillusionment, pain, and conflict in their own lives and offer hope as they share their personal struggles of reconciliation and healing. You and your spouse will find courage and strength in the realization that you are not alone in your struggle. You will not be asked to share your problems with anyone else. However, you will be encouraged to put the past behind you and to look beyond the hurt and pain, to rediscover each other in a new and positive way. The Retrouvaille Weekend provides tools to help you with communication, forgiveness, and trust. It teaches a dialogue process of meaningful communication on a feeling level.
Phase 2: The Post Weekend Sessions
A series of follow-up presentations is the next important phase of the Retrouvaille healing process. The hurt and pain of a struggling marriage cannot be healed in a single weekend experience, though it is a positive start. The Post sessions include a series of 2-hour talks by additional couples that expand on the Weekend concepts. The Post sessions are offered, over either a 6-week period featuring two talks on Sunday afternoons or 12-week period featuring one talk on a Thursday evening. Most couples, without a doubt, find this to be one of the most productive components of the program and where the most growth in the marriage occurs.
Phase 3: Monthly Support (CORE)
The final phase is a monthly small-group support meeting, called CORE (Continuing Our Retrouvaille Experience). It allows for a casual and supportive interaction with other couples who have attended the Retrouvaille program. This monthly meeting continues to reinforce the communication tools learned on the weekend and it is a positive and welcoming online experienced that allows couples to form strong and lasting bonds as they continue to heal their marriages.
